Ancient Greek Silver Akragas Sicily Didrachm Crab Coin - 480 BC
An ancient Greek silver didrachm from Akragas. Sicily, stuck circa 495- 480 B.C. The obverse(image ii) with sea eagle standing left. The legend reading: ΑΚΡΑ[CΑΝΤΟΣ] Of Akragas" The reverse(image i) with open clawed crab within shallow incuse circle. The ancient city of Akragas was founded by colonists from Gela in around 580 B.C. and grew to become a wealthy and important city throughout the 5th Century. Akragas began to issue her iconic coinage a few decades later and chose the eagle. A symbol of the Father of the Gods, Zeus, to whom a large temple was dedicated in Akragas, as their obverse depiction. The reverse shows a freshwater crab, likely a popular delicacy harvested in the region. Diameter: 21 mm. Weight: 8.65 g. Ex British private collection. Please note; this is a genuine. Pantikápaion) antique city in the eastern Crimea(modern Kerch) Founded in the 1 st half of 6. BC. er. came from Miletus. May have previously located there Ionian trading ... morestation( Emporia) The city's name probably dates back to the Iranian roots: Pantikapaion- fishy way that could denote fishy Kerch Strait. On the shores of which the city was founded. Pantikápaion quickly turned into a major city. Ahead of the other Greek settlements in the area. Already in the 2 nd half of the 6. BC. er. Pantikápaion began to mint its silver coin(a 4-in. BC. E. and a gold and copper) In the 1 st half of the 5. BC. er. around P. united the Greek city located on both sides of the Kerch Strait(Cimmerian Bosporus) Which formed the Bosporus state. Pantikápaion as its capital and the main shopping. Crafts and cultural center. In its heyday P. occupied about 100 hectares. Back in 6. BC. er. He was surrounded by a defensive wall. The city settled on the slopes and foothills of the Rocky Mountains(modern Mount Mithridates) At the top was the acropolis with temples and public buildings. NOTES: Upon request we can set your gemstones as a ring. Pendant, or as earrings(click for more information) DETAIL: Ancient Mediterranean cultures(Greek. Roman, Persian, Celt) believed that a garnet could give its wearer guidance in the night, allowing them to see when others could not. Garnet was also worn for protection when traveling, as garnet was believed to warn the wearer of approaching danger. The ancient Greeks believed it guarded children from drowning, and it was also thought to be a potent antidote ... moreagainst poisons. The ancient Persians regarded garnet as a royal stone, and only royalty was allowed to possess the gemstone. According to ancient Hebrew mythology, a giant garnet provided interior lighting for Noah's Ark. It is also believed that garnet, described as“nopek” was one of the twelve gemstones described in the Bible in Exodus 28:17-20 as adorning Aaron’s breastplate, representing the twelve tribes of ancient Israel. DETAIL: Tourmaline occurred in many of the ancient mines that yielded precious gemstones in the ancient Roman world 2.000 years ago, however it was mistaken for(and thus called) emerald or topaz. Tourmaline was correctly identified and described in the ancient world by Theophrastus of Ancient Greece(student and successor of Plato and Aristotle) in 314 B.C. The name“tourmaline” came from the Celanese word"turmali, which means"mixed" Bright rainbow collections of gemstone varieties were called"turmali" parcels. In ancient mythology, tourmaline was found in all colors because it traveled along a rainbow and gathered all the rainbow's colors. Latinized as Nicephorus Callistus Xanthopulus( Νικηφόρος Κάλλιστος Ξανθόπουλος) Of. The last of the Greek ecclesiastical historians, flourished around 1320. His Historia Ecclesiastica. In eighteen books, brings the narrative down to 610; for the first four centuries the author is largely dependent on his predecessors, And. His additions showing very little critical faculty; for the later period his labours, based on documents now no longer extant, to which he had free access, though he used them also with small discrimination, are much more valuable. A table of contents of another five books. Continuing the history to the death of in 911. Also exists, but whether the books were ever actually written is doubtful. Some modern scholars are of opinion that Nicephorus appropriated and passed off as his own the work of an unknown author of the 10th century. The plan of the work is good and, in spite of its fables and superstitious absurdities, contains important facts which would otherwise have been unknown. Significance of oil lamps in major religions of the Holy Land: Judaism Lamps appear in the Torah and other Jewish sources as a symbol of“lighting” the way for the righteous. The wise, and for love and other positive values. While fire was often described as being destructive, light was given a positive spiritual meaning. The oil lamp and its light were important household items, and this may explain their symbolism. Oil lamps were used for many spiritual rituals. The oil lamp and its light also became important ritualistic articles with the further development of Jewish culture and its religion. Mysia, Kyzicos "Roaring Lion and Boar Tunny Fish" ANCIENT GREEK SILVER COIN
Travel with me now to mighty Kyzicos. Obverse: Forepart of boar running left. Upright tunny fish behind Reverse: Head of lion roaring left. Star above Grose 7577. SNG Cop 49, Ex Amphora Coins Silver Hemiobol 480-450 BC Kyzicos Mint 9.5X7.7mm 0.34g A trip to the ancient world would not be complete without a trip to Cyzicus. Or Kyzicos, a place that many historians call one of the greatest cities of the ancient world. Kyzicos/Cyzicus was located in Mysia. This region was settled when Mysians came from Thrace with the great Aegean migrations in about 1200 B.C. They occupied lands in a region of Asia Minor in northwest Anatolia on the south coast of the Sea of Marmara. Cyzicus became one of Mysia's most important citie s. Gaining economic superiority because of it's strategic location along trade routes and it's access to the sea. ... moreCyzicus fell under Athenian rule during the Peloponnesian War. In 410 B.C. Athens destroyed a Spartan fleet at the Battle of Cyzicus. In 387 B.C. Cyzicus was given over to Persian rule, but was recaptured by Alexander The Great in 334 B.C. This awesome little relic is a running boar and a tunny fish, like a tuna. The reverse shows an image of a roaring lion. Authenticity guaranteed. The immense issues of coinage made in the name of Alexander the Great for a topic which could occupy the pages of a large volume. Obviously it is not possible. In a work of this scope, to do justice to such a subject. As in the case of Philip II, coinage in the name of Alexander continued long after the king's death. No doubt this was largely due to the lack of an effective successor to the imperial throne. Almost two decades ... morewere to elapse before Alexander's generals, his true successors, felt sufficiently secure to take the title of'king' and to issue coinage in their own names. Although he began his career as King of Macedon, Alexander spent only the first two years of his reign in his native kingdom, and by the time of his death, at the age of thirty three, he ruled a vast empire stretching from Greece to India. Consequently, his coinage was on an imperial scale, unlike those of his predecessors, and was struck at a multitude of mints in many lands, often replacing an existing autonomous series. nevertheless, the Macedonian mint of Amphipolis remained one of the principal sources of currency. In later ages(3rd-2nd century B.C. the types of Alexander's silver coinage were revived by various cities as they regained a measure of autonomy from the declining Hellenistic Monarchies. Popularly known to history as Alexander the Great. Mégas Aléxandros" was an Ancient Greek king( basileus) of Macedon. Born in 356 BC. 2,400 yr old "Ancient Greek Coin Thrace Maroneia"
Extra Fine Ancient Greek Bronze Coin 400 B.C.300 B.C. Thrace Maroneia" Date: 400B.C. Weight: 3.1 grams Diameter: 14.2 This coin came from the ancient city-state of Maroneia Greece. A leading center of trade on the shores of the Agean Sea. This coin bears a prancing horse on the obverse and grape vines within a square with four bunches of grapes on the reverse. The city of maroneia was noted for its fine wine and great horses. Its wine was famous through out the regions and was located at the base of Mt. Ismaros. Ancient Greek Silver Alexander the Great Lysimachos Tetradrachm Coin - 306 BC
A superb example of a fascinating and important coin type. An ancient Greek silver tetradrachm of one of the succesors to King Alexander the Great. King Lysimachos. Struck 306- 281 B.C. at the Magnesia mint. The obverse depicts a powerful portrait of the diademed head of the deified. Alexander the Great shown with unruly hair and wearing the horn of Ammon. The reverse with the goddess. Athena enthroned and facing to the left, holding the winged goddess, Nike and resting arm on shield, spear behind, torch in left field. The inscription reading; ΒΑΣΙΛΣΩΣ ΛΥΣΙΜΑΧΟΥ"Of King Lysimachos" The Lysimachos tetradrachmas are particularly well known and important coin types. It is these coins which are believed to show the earliest depiction of one of the greatest rulers and military tacticians ever to have lived. Alexander the Great. Ancient Greek ! ATHENS OWL Silver TETRADRACHM, New Style 500 B.C.
ATHENS OWL Silver TETRADRACHM New Style c.500 B.C. Weight: 16.6 grams Size: 26 mm Fine silver! Historical Context: Extremely Desirable Genuine 2400 Year Old Greek Silver Tetradrachm of Athens. This coin was minted in Athens about 450 BC. Throughout most of the 5th century BC. After the Persian defeat, Athens ruled the Aegean world and became a great cultural and political center. The Peloponnesian War, 431-404 BC, drained Athens of her wealth, which led the way for Sparta and later the Macedonian Empire under Philip II(Father of Alexander the Great) to take control of the Greek World. Among the Most Important and Artistic Coinage Types of Classical Greek Antiquity Featuring a Gorgeous Portrait of the Goddess Athena Wearing a Crested Helmet Decorated with Olive Leaves. Also Featuring a Bold Scene of One of the Ancient World's Most Recognized ... moreSymbols- The Athens Owl! Obv: Head of Athena right with profile eye. Wearing necklace with pendants, round earring, and crested Attic helmet ornamented with three olive leaves above visor and spiral palmette of“ form” on bowl Rev: owl standing three-quarters right. Olive spray and crescent moon behind, A Θ E( Athens" Diameter: 26.0 mm(the size of a US Quarter but 3 times as thick) Weight: 16.6 grams Condition: Naturally toned. With one ancient test cut on reverse on owl's neck(applied in the early 4th century BC because of the plated emergency issue of Athenian silver coins at the end of the Peloponnesian War) Reference: http:www.coinarchives.com/a/lotviewer.php?LotID=182766&AucID=233&Lot=5661 The artistry and mythological subjects of ancient Greek coins have always been a tremendous lure to collectors. Ancient Greek Coin TEOS IONIA SILVER DIOBOL Seated Griffin & Lyre RARE i1387
AUTHENTIC SILVER DIOBOL OF TEOS IONIA FROM 320- 294 BC. OBVERSE– Griffin seated right. Left forepaw raised REVERSE– Lyre Weight: 1.02 grams Size: 9.7 mm According to the ancient historians Teos was founded in the 9th Century BC by the Minyans coming from Orchomenus in Boeotia. Some other groups later came from various parts of Ionia and Athens and settled in this new city. Its outstanding position between two perfect harbors proved very advantageous to develop strong trade relations with other cities in the Aegean and the Mediterranean coastline. Towards the middle of the 7th Century BC Teos achieved a considerable amount of importance so much so that Thales of Miletus proposed it to be the political center of the Panionic League. However. This sensible idea was not adopted and, when the Persians invaded the region, this lack of common policy ... moreand strength brought about the downfall of the Ionians. Many of the citizens of Teos then set sail and founded the city of Abdera in Thrace. However, it seems quite probable that soon afterwards they returned as Teos supplied 17 ships to the Ionian fleet, which were wiped out by the Persians at the battle of Lade in 494 BC. With the arrival of Alexander the Great. Teos gained its freedom from Persian rule. Later it came under the rule of Antigonus and successively of Lysimachus who moved some of its citizens to the newly built city of Ephesus. Teos possessed the largest temple dedicated to Dionysus. The god of wine and creative powers of nature. As he was the patron deity of agriculture, drama, and theatre, it is no accident that in the 3C BC Teos was selected as the center of the Guild of the Artists of Dionysus. At the very beginning. The Teians were happy for the presence of these artists. However, after their artistic temperaments and arrogant behaviors started to cause endless troubles and quarrels, the members of the guild were forced to move first to Ephesus, getting worse there, their center was moved several times until they were finally settled at Lebedus.
